General Summary
The US Field Reimbursement Manager at Penumbra is responsible for developing and communicating the clinical and economic value of the Penumbra interventional therapy portfolio of products. In collaboration with the Penumbra sales organization, the Field Reimbursement Manager will differentiate Penumbra through direct interaction with customers in both clinical and healthcare administration settings. This role will provide field-based reimbursement support to stakeholders (C-suite, hospital administration, payers, and physicians), with a near-term focus of educating and supporting our customers.

Specific Duties and Responsibilities
•Execute reimbursement, health economics, and value selling strategies to promote growth of the Intervention Therapies business to Penumbra’s customers/stakeholders (C-suite, hospital administration, payers, and physicians). *
•Build and maintain strategic working relationships with customers (C-suite, hospital administration, payers, and physicians) and develop economic key opinion leaders.
•Work in partnership with sales, strategic accounts & market access teams to plan and prioritize customer visits to deliver value selling messages. *
•Collaborate with colleagues to provide insight on market intelligence and reimbursement trends and inform the development of customer-facing tools, economic models, and other tactical elements of reimbursement to facilitate patient access to interventional therapy products. *
•Educate and train the sales team on health economic tools and messaging both in- person and via virtual meetings. *
•Develop relationships with physician champions to support interactions with hospital administrators and health plan decision-makers.
•Ensure health economic and value selling methodologies and messages are consistent and compliant with legal and regulatory guidance. *
•Maintain expert level reimbursement knowledge (policies, coding, coverage, payment) for all interventional therapy products.
•Provide education and training to healthcare providers, office staff, and sales organizations on reimbursement processes, coding requirements, and billing procedures. Work in collaboration with legal, compliance, and other business groups to assure appropriate customer engagement processes are strictly followed. *
•Assist healthcare providers to optimize reimbursement by ensuring accurate documentation and coding practices. *
•Assist with appeal and denial management in cases where insurance claims are denied, or coverage is inadequate and help healthcare providers navigate the appeals process.*
•Build and maintain relationships with political and policy stakeholders at the federal, state, and local levels to ensure that Penumbra is positioned as a key stakeholder in policy issues of importance to our business in the US. *
•Adhere to the Company’s Quality Management System (QMS) as well as domestic and global quality system regulations, standards, and procedures. *
•Understand relevant security, privacy and compliance principles and adhere to the regulations, standards, and procedures that are applicable to the Company. *
•Ensure other members of the department follow the QMS, regulations, standards, and procedures. *
•Perform other work-related duties as assigned.
*Indicates an essential function of the role

Position Qualifications
Minimum education and experience:
•Bachelor's degree with a focus in health policy, health economics, healthcare administration, health services, or a related field, with 5+ years of experience guiding Reimbursement and Health Economics strategies for a medical device manufacturer, or an equivalent combination of education and experience.

Additional qualifications:
•In-depth knowledge of US healthcare policy and payment systems, including Medicare and commercial payers, physicians, and hospital reimbursement for inpatient and outpatient sites of service is required.
•Experience and a high degree of comfort presenting complex health economics information to influential groups of varying size and level in a way that engages the audience, is easy to understand, and fosters trust is a necessity.
•Experience educating clinicians and facilities administrators on appropriate documentation and billing for innovative medical technologies, as well as training healthcare providers and sales organizations on the reimbursement process while simultaneously providing denial support
•Experience using financial calculators, with intermediate skills in Excel and PowerPoint to demonstrate how interventional therapy products impact facility economics or healthcare systems, both economically and financially.
•Ability to present complex health economic information to both large and small influential groups in a way that is credible, easy to understand and engages the audience.
•Ability to communicate and train healthcare providers and sales organization on reimbursement process and provide denial support.
•Strong oral, written, and interpersonal communication skills with the ability to develop relationships at all levels within an organization to influence related business decisions.
•High degree of accuracy and attention to detail.
•Excellent organizational skills with ability to prioritize assignments while handling various projects simultaneously.
